You most definitely can do that on Linux. When you set up your user account on install is where you'd ask that or prompt on upgrade if the age isn't there. It can be handled and I've been watching the discussions on Ubuntu dev mailing lists about how to address it and at what level. If they're talking, the RHEL guys are almost certainly doing the same because they have corporate contracts they need to provide compliance for (which trickles down to us end users). It can be done, whether or not the community chooses to participate is a different story. The fun Q is if it'll be standardized initially or we get competing implementations like usual.

Discussions are talking about all the existing laws they have to comply with from both the providing info side as well as the protecting info side (some jurisdictions want privacy as a priority for a wide variety of reasons). So, it's coming, but I'm sure like most Linux stuff you can choose your own adventure.

The ELI5 is a CDN is a network of servers that replicate and redistribute the traffic load for a given resource. Know that whenever you witness the "reddit hug of death" or anything of that nature when a server gets overloaded, CDNs exist to prevent that.
